CMV Zebra for Candle Labels and Boutique Packaging
Testing CMV Zebra on candle labels was a revelation. The font’s bold, striped character mimics the natural markings of a zebra, giving each label a sense of movement and energy. I used it for the product name and scent description, and it added a playful yet sophisticated touch that stood out on my packaging. Whether paired with a rustic wood background or a clean white card, CMV Zebra brought a unique visual identity to my boutique-style candles.
For small businesses, this font is ideal for product tags, gift tags, and seasonal packaging. Its high contrast and distinctive shape make it perfect for short phrases that need to command attention without overwhelming the design. I found it especially effective when used alongside a simple sans serif font for secondary text, creating a balanced and professional look.

CMV Zebra for Digital Printables and Creative Templates
As a printable creator, I often think about how a font will perform across different formats. CMV Zebra holds up well in digital downloads, whether used for printable wall art, planner pages, or social media graphics. Its sharp lines and clear structure make it easy to read at smaller sizes, which is essential for printables that users might download and print at home.
I used it in a set of holiday greeting cards, pairing it with a soft handwritten font for the message. The contrast between the two fonts created a layered, personalized feel that customers loved. It also worked well in SVG designs for Cricut and Silhouette machines, where precision is key. Just be sure to test it at the smallest sizes before cutting, as some decorative elements may not hold up under tight cuts.
